🎯 Учимся вводить данные в таблицу в MySQL с помощью простых шагов

Чтобы ввести данные в таблицу в MySQL, вы можете использовать оператор INSERT INTO.

Вот пример:

INSERT INTO название_таблицы (столбец1, столбец2, столбец3) VALUES (значение1, значение2, значение3);

В этом примере, название_таблицы - это название вашей таблицы, столбец1, столбец2, столбец3 - это названия столбцов в таблице, а значение1, значение2, значение3 - это значения, которые вы хотите ввести в соответствующие столбцы.

Вы можете указать только нужные столбцы и их значения:

INSERT INTO название_таблицы (столбец1, столбец2) VALUES (значение1, значение2);

Вы также можете вставить значения из другой таблицы с помощью SELECT:

INSERT INTO название_таблицы (столбец1, столбец2) SELECT столбец1, столбец2 FROM другая_таблица WHERE условие;

Обратите внимание, что вам нужно заменить "название_таблицы", "столбец1", "столбец2" и т.д. своими соответствующими именами.

Детальный ответ

Как ввести данные в таблицу в MySQL

MySQL является одной из самых популярных реляционных систем управления базами данных, и знание, как вводить данные в таблицу, является важным навыком для работы с этой базой данных. В данной статье мы рассмотрим несколько способов ввода данных в таблицу в MySQL.

1. Ввод данных с помощью оператора INSERT

Наиболее распространенный способ ввода данных в таблицу - использование оператора INSERT. Этот оператор позволяет указать имя таблицы и значения, которые нужно вставить в каждый столбец этой таблицы.

Вот пример использования оператора INSERT:

IN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, value3, ...);

В этом примере "table_name" - это имя таблицы, в которую вы хотите вставить данные. "column1", "column2", "column3" и т. д. - это имена столбцов таблицы, в которые вы хотите вставить значения. "value1", "value2", "value3" и т. д. - это значения, которые вы хотите вставить в каждый столбец.

Например, предположим, что у нас есть таблица "users" с тремя столбцами: "id" (тип INT), "name" (тип VARCHAR) и "age" (тип INT). Чтобы вставить данные в эту таблицу, мы можем использовать следующий код:

INSERT INTO users (id, name, age)
VALUES (1, 'John', 25);

Этот код вставит новую запись в таблицу "users" с указанными значениями "id", "name" и "age".

2. Ввод данных с помощью команды LOAD DATA INFILE

Если у вас есть большой набор данных, которые вы хотите ввести в таблицу, вы можете использовать команду LOAD DATA INFILE. Эта команда позволяет вам загрузить данные из файла непосредственно в таблицу.

Вот пример использования команды LOAD DATA INFILE:

LOAD DATA INFILE 'filename.txt' INTO TABLE table_name;

В этом примере "filename.txt" - это имя файла, содержащего данные, которые вы хотите ввести в таблицу. "table_name" - это имя таблицы, в которую вы хотите вставить данные.

Например, предположим, что у нас есть файл "data.txt", содержащий данные для таблицы "users". Чтобы ввести эти данные в таблицу "users", мы можем использовать следующий код:

LOAD DATA INFILE 'data.txt' INTO TABLE users;

Эта команда загрузит данные из файла "data.txt" и вставит их в таблицу "users".

3. Ввод данных с помощью команды INSERT SELECT

Кроме того, вы можете вводить данные в таблицу с использованием команды INSERT SELECT. Эта команда позволяет вам выбрать данные из одной таблицы и вставить их в другую таблицу.

Вот пример использования команды INSERT SELECT:

INSERT INTO table_name (column1, column2, column3, ...)
SELECT column1, column2, column3, ...
FROM another_table
WHERE condition;

В этом примере "table_name" - это имя таблицы, в которую вы хотите вставить данные. "column1", "column2", "column3" и т. д. - это имена столбцов таблицы, в которые вы хотите вставить значения. "another_table" - это таблица, из которой вы хотите выбрать данные. "condition" - это условие, которому должны соответствовать данные.

Например, предположим, что у нас есть таблица "users" с тремя столбцами: "id" (тип INT), "name" (тип VARCHAR) и "age" (тип INT), и у нас также есть таблица "new_users" с теми же столбцами. Чтобы вставить данные из таблицы "users" в таблицу "new_users", мы можем использовать следующий код:

INSERT INTO new_users (id, name, age)
SELECT id, name, age
FROM users
WHERE condition;

Этот код выберет данные из таблицы "users" и вставит их в таблицу "new_users" с указанными столбцами.

Заключение

В данной статье мы рассмотрели несколько способов ввода данных в таблицу в MySQL. Оператор INSERT позволяет вам вставлять значения непосредственно в столбцы таблицы, команда LOAD DATA INFILE позволяет вам загружать данные из файла, а команда INSERT SELECT позволяет вам выбирать данные из одной таблицы и вставлять их в другую.

Надеюсь, эта статья помогла вам разобраться в процессе ввода данных в таблицу в MySQL. Удачи с вашими базами данных и программированием!

Видео по теме

Создание базы данных MySQL Workbench

Уроки MySQL | Как добавить данные в таблицу. PDO, mysqli.

QA 4. Добавление данных (INSERT INTO) в MySQL Workbench

Похожие статьи:

🎯 Учимся вводить данные в таблицу в MySQL с помощью простых шагов